Who Is Nicole Laeno? (The Wholesome Influencer Image)
Before diving into the nicole laeno vape rumor, it’s important to understand who Nicole Laeno is.
Nicole is a dancer, YouTuber, and TikTok creator known for her upbeat personality, close family bond, and polished “clean girl” aesthetic. Her videos rarely involve controversy, drama, or anything that would harm her wholesome public image. She has also openly shared her journey at SDSU (San Diego State University), focusing on friendships, dorm life, and personal growth.
Because of that, the idea of a nicole laeno vaping scandal feels out of place to most longtime fans.
Origin of the Nicole Laeno Vape Rumors
Like many influencer controversies, the nicole laeno vaping rumor didn’t come from a verified source. It mostly appeared in:
- TikTok edits claiming to show “Nicole vaping”
- Reddit threads asking if anyone had “seen the video”
- Discord screenshots with zero proof
- Clickbait accounts using her name for views
None of these posts provided real evidence. Instead, they relied on blurry screenshots or unrelated clips meant to generate shock value.
Analyzing the “Evidence”: Real or Fake?

Most posts fueling the nicole laeno vape rumor fall into three categories:
1. Blurry clips with no identifiable face
Many so-called “nicole laeno vaping video” posts show a girl holding a vape, but the person doesn’t even look like Nicole. These appear to be random party clips mislabeled for clicks.
2. AI-edited or deepfake-style images
As AI-generated content rises, influencers are becoming common targets. The nicole laeno vape rumors may be the result of manipulated photos or deepfake TikToks made to spark controversy.
3. Misinterpretations of normal objects
Some fan edits have taken pictures of Nicole holding items, like pens, markers, or makeup, and framed them as vapes. This is typical of TikTok misinformation.
So far, there is still no verified video, picture, or evidence confirming that Nicole Laeno vapes.
